Healthcare Costs are Slowing Down
Via Sarah Kliff, a team of researchers suggests that U.S. healthcare costs really are slowing down — and they've been slowing down since well before the current economic downturn. The data is noisy, but it fits with other studies suggesting an even longer term slowing of healthcare costs. Sarah has more at the link.
